Experimental And Analytical Studies On Highly Efficient Regenerative Characteristics Of A 20-Kw Class Hts Induction/Synchronous Motor
IEEE Transactions on Applied Superconductivity(2017)
Abstract
This paper presents regeneration characteristics of a 20-kW class high- temperature superconductor induction/synchronous motor (HTS- ISM). It has experimentally been demonstrated that the HTS-ISM generates synchronous electric power at about rated condition (20 kW), and the corresponding efficiency is more than 90%. The tested characteristics have also been reproduced based on the nonlinear electrical equivalent circuit. These results clearly show the possibility of highly efficient synchronous regeneration performance.
